WILSON v. ALBUQUERQUE BOARD OF REALTORS

No. 666.

487 P.2d 145 (1971)

82 N.M. 717

William R. WILSON, Plaintiff-Appellant, v. ALBUQUERQUE BOARD OF REALTORS, Defendant-Appellee.

Court of Appeals of New Mexico.

June 18, 1971.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

William R. Wilson, Albuquerque, pro se.

Dennis J. Falk, Modrall, Sperling, Roehl, Harris & Sisk, Albuquerque, for appellee.


OPINION

WOOD, Judge.

1. Matters not disclosed by the record are not considered because they are outside the scope of appellate review. Southern Union Gas Company v. Taylor, 82 N.M. 670, 486 P.2d 606, decided June 7, 1971. 2. Reed v. Melnick, 81 N.M. 608, 471 P.2d 178 (1970) sets forth the method for pleading and proving libel. 3. Points on appeal not argued...
